APP下载

CAE软件操作小百科(28)

2015-11-12李锦龙

计算机辅助工程 2015年5期
关键词:后处理后缀构件

李锦龙

1在RecurDyn建模过程中会出现需要更改模型单位的情况,而事实上不能在原模型上直接改,那么要重新建模吗?

不需要重新建模,模型是可以整体复制的.可以新建窗口,在新的单位下把原来的模型复制过去就可以了.

2在模型的建立与仿真运动分析中,模型中会显示各种颜色参差不齐的连接线,干扰操作与观测,如何避免这种问题?

在工作窗口的建模工具条中,将Icon Size选项(见图1)窗口中的数值设置的小一些,也可将Icon On/Off(见图1)中的选项全部取消勾选,这样可以将模型中的各种标线缩小到理想尺寸或不显示出来,方便模型部件的选取与仿真观察.

3后处理分析有时需要把2次或多次仿真后的不同数据放在一张plot曲线图中,这项功能如何操作执行?

在后处理中执行File→Import,选择要进行比较的后缀为rplt的文件,这样就可以在同一张plot曲线中显示多次仿真的结果.

4对于复杂构件模型,如何快速准确地选取内部构件?

对于复杂模型,用鼠标选取某一构件时不太好选,这时可以在屏幕右边的数据库窗口栏(见图2)中找出对应的构件名称选取.另外,对于细长的模型,用鼠标点击模型两端部位比较容易选中.

5再次打开之前建好的模型时,如何对模型进行修改?

打开之前建立的模型,模型参数是锁定的,此时,在屏幕右边的数据库窗口菜单中选中模型,右键单击,点击Edit选项即可显示模型内部结构并修改其参数.

6基于RecurDyn的二次开发,在编写子程序与程序调用的过程中要注意哪些细节?

基于RecurDyn的二次开发软件一般是C或Fortran语言软件,软件安装要与RecynDyn软件版本相符,且必须先安装RecynDyn软件,否则不能正常识别与运行.子程序的编写要选取恰当的参数,方便在RecurDyn上调用生成的动态链接库时对参数的输入,动态链接库的命名必须是英文且有一定的格式,调用过程前最好把动态链接库与模型文件夹放在一起.

7如何在RecurDyn中精确移动物体?

在操作页面的工具栏中间处点击Object Control按钮或者在菜单栏中Edit→Object Control→Basic,就可以实现精确的三维平移和转动.

8在后处理分析过程中,发现部分plot曲线明显突然紊乱(如图3),如何排查出现这类问题的原因?

出现这类问题,一般考虑2个方面:一是仿真模型建立的是否合理,二是相关参数的设置是否正确.

对于一个普通模型,排查这2项内容的工作量会很

大,而且容易有漏洞,因此可以通过查看模型在仿真运动过程中是否出现卡壳现象初步判断问题出现的地方,比如在部件振动过程中,会不会被其他部位零件挡住,出现卡顿现象.这样就可以有目的地找到问题所在.

9在比较复杂、仿真计算精度要求高的仿真运动分析中,有没有提高计算速计算速度的方法?

由于计算精度有一定要求,那么单位时间内的计算步数不能太小,此时可以通过适当缩短结束时间(即End Time不宜太大)的方法缩短仿真计算时间.此外,在点击Simulate按钮之前,可以先将Hide RecurDyn during Simulate按钮选中,在隐藏工作窗口的前提下,软件在后台计算的速度会加快.

10一些实用的快捷操作和容易忽略的常识

1)快捷操作.

平移模型:T.旋转模型:R.放大缩小模型:Z.使模型适应屏幕的大小:F.弹出属性对话框:P.后退撤消:Ctrl+Z.建立新窗口:Ctrl+N.再打开一个已有模型文件或图形文件:Ctrl+O.

2)易忽略的常识.

模型数据文件命名后缀为rmd;模型数据及结果数据库文件命名后缀为rdyn;子系统文件命名后缀为rdsb;模型命名不支持中划线、空格等特殊字符;单位制选择类型有3种,其中CGS类型对应的力学单位为达因(dyn),1 N=1×105 dyn.

(摘自同济大学郑百林教授《CAE操作技能与实践》课堂讲义)

猜你喜欢

后处理后缀构件
基于构件的软件工程技术与理论方法探讨
倍增法之后缀数组解决重复子串的问题
基于Python的Abaqus二次开发在空间可展单簧片结构仿真分析中的应用
两种方法实现非常规文本替换
基于UG的变螺距螺旋槽建模及数控加工编程
从型号后缀认识CPU性能
银镜反应和后续处理的实验改进
WHSC/WHTC与ESC/ETC测试循环的试验比较与研究
武汉工地钢材贴上电子标签
基于构件的软件开发实践